Excel公式中的在不使用YEAR函数的条件下来自日期文本中的年份识别技术

在Excel中,如果你不想使用YEAR函数来从日期文本中提取年份,你可以使用一些文本处理技巧。假设你的日期存储在A1单元格中,你可以在另一个单元格中使用以下公式来提取年份:

```excel
=LEFT(A1, INSTR(A1, /) - 1)
```

这个公式的思路是:
1. 使用`INSTR(A1, /)`找到日期字符串中第一个斜杠的位置。
2. 使用`LEFT(A1, INSTR(A1, /) - 1)`提取从开始到斜杠之前的所有字符,即年份。

请注意,这个公式假设你的日期格式是“月/日/年”。如果你的日期格式不同(例如“日/月/年”或“年/月/日”),你可能需要调整公式以适应不同的格式。

例如,如果你的日期格式是“年/月/日”,你可以使用以下公式:

```excel
=LEFT(A1, INSTR(A1, /) - 1)
```

这个公式仍然可以正常工作,因为它只提取斜杠之前的部分。

如果你需要处理更复杂的日期格式或更多的特殊情况,可能需要编写更复杂的文本处理函数或使用VBA宏来实现。

原创文章,作者:LifeTo.Fun,如若转载,请注明出处:https://www.lifeto.fun/archives/741

Like (0)
Previous 2025年3月22日
Next 2025年3月22日

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注